linux服务器连接hive库命令

不及物动词 其他 40

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要连接Hive库,需要使用Hive命令行界面或者Hive JDBC驱动的方式。

    1. 使用Hive命令行界面连接Hive库的步骤如下:
    a. 打开终端,输入以下命令以启动Hive命令行界面:
    “`
    hive
    “`
    b. 输入以下命令以连接Hive库:
    “`
    jdbc:hive2://:/<数据库名称>;auth=noSasl
    “`
    其中,``是Hive服务器的IP地址或者主机名,``是Hive服务器监听的端口号,`<数据库名称>`是要连接的Hive库的名称。
    c. 输入用户名和密码进行认证,即可成功连接Hive库。

    2. 使用Hive JDBC驱动连接Hive库的步骤如下:
    a. 下载Hive JDBC驱动包,可以从Apache Hive官网或者Maven仓库获取。
    b. 在Java应用程序中,通过引入Hive JDBC驱动包,并导入相应的类,使用以下代码连接Hive库:
    “`java
    import java.sql.Connection;
    import java.sql.DriverManager;
    import java.sql.SQLException;

    public class HiveConnectionExample {
    public static void main(String[] args) {
    Connection connection = null;

    try {
    // 加载Hive JDBC驱动
    Class.forName(“org.apache.hive.jdbc.HiveDriver”);

    // 创建连接
    connection = DriverManager.getConnection(“jdbc:hive2://:/<数据库名称>“, “<用户名>“, “<密码>“);

    System.out.println(“连接成功!”);
    } catch (ClassNotFoundException e) {
    System.out.println(“找不到Hive JDBC驱动!”);
    e.printStackTrace();
    } catch (SQLException e) {
    System.out.println(“连接Hive库失败!”);
    e.printStackTrace();
    } finally {
    // 关闭连接
    if (connection != null) {
    try {
    connection.close();
    } catch (SQLException e) {
    e.printStackTrace();
    }
    }
    }
    }
    }
    “`
    其中,``、``和`<数据库名称>`分别替换为实际的Hive服务器地址、端口和要连接的Hive库的名称。另外,`<用户名>`和`<密码>`用于认证连接。

    以上就是连接Linux服务器中Hive库的命令。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要连接Hive库,你可以使用以下命令:

    1. 首先,打开终端并登录到你的Linux服务器。

    2. 使用以下命令安装Hive客户端:sudo apt-get install hive

    3. 运行以下命令以开始Hive服务:hive –service metastore &

    4. 使用以下命令连接Hive:hive

    5. 如果提示找不到Hive CLI,请尝试以下命令:hive –service hiveserver2 –hiveconf hive.server2.thrift.port=10000

    注意:以上命令假设你已经正确安装了Hive,并将其设置为你的环境变量。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    连接Hive库的命令是通过Hive的命令行工具hive执行的。下面是连接Hive库的步骤和相应的命令。

    1. 打开终端,并登录到Linux服务器。

    2. 输入以下命令连接Hive库:

    “`
    hive
    “`

    3. 如果需要指定连接的Hive服务器地址和端口号,可以使用以下命令:

    “`
    hive –service metastore thrift://localhost:9083
    “`

    其中,localhost为Hive服务器地址,9083为端口号。

    4. 输入用户名和密码以进行身份验证。如果没有设置用户名和密码,则可以直接按Enter键。

    5. 成功连接到Hive库后,可以使用Hive提供的命令进行操作。以下是一些常用的Hive命令示例:

    – 查看数据库列表:

    “`
    show databases;
    “`

    – 创建数据库:

    “`
    create database mydatabase;
    “`

    – 切换到指定数据库:

    “`
    use mydatabase;
    “`

    – 查看数据库中的表:

    “`
    show tables;
    “`

    – 创建表:

    “`
    create table mytable (col1 string, col2 int);
    “`

    – 插入数据到表中:

    “`
    insert into mytable values (‘value1’, 123);
    “`

    – 查询表中的数据:

    “`
    select * from mytable;
    “`

    – 删除数据库:

    “`
    drop database mydatabase;
    “`

    注意:命令示例中的mydatabase、mytable、col1和col2是示例的数据库和表名以及列名,可以根据实际需求进行调整。

    6. 使用完毕后,可以输入”exit;”命令退出Hive库。

    以上是连接Hive库的一般步骤和相关命令。根据实际的环境和需求,可能会有一些特殊的设置或配置。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部